Output ad344532e8d0e0bf68d687c3c5a39b16316b8f9bca403cf57c374bfb3939a2f7:0

value
22400000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9bcf408f7a99762a67ba268614854354a9878037 OP_EQUAL
address
3FtrwQrLP9dDs9PuV3TbfveSeUQWvVCyqx
transaction
ad344532e8d0e0bf68d687c3c5a39b16316b8f9bca403cf57c374bfb3939a2f7
spent
true